Cedar Roofing
Timeless Beauty with Natural Insulation
There is no substitute for the rustic, organic character of a genuine cedar roof. Popular in Fishers, Carmel, and historic Indianapolis neighborhoods, cedar offers a unique aesthetic that matures gracefully over time. 3 Kings Roofing and Gutter sources high-quality cedar products that provide exceptional thermal performance and weather protection.

Natural Insulator: Cedar wood has a high R-value naturally, helping to keep your attic c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ter compared to asphalt.
Storm Resilience: Despite its natural appearance, cedar is incredibly resilient against hail and strong winds, often outperforming synthetic materials in impact tests.
Distinctive Aging: Your roof will transition from a fresh, warm tone to a distinguished silver-gray patina, adding to the historic or cottage charm of your property.
Services
Cedar Roof Repair
Maintenance is key to extending the life of a wood roof. We provide expert repairs including replacing individual split or curled shakes, installing zinc strips to prevent moss growth, and ensuring your flashing is directing water away from the wood.
Cedar Roof Replacement
Installing a cedar roof requires specialized craftsmanship. We focus heavily on ventilation—using cedar breather products and proper spacing—to allow the wood to dry out evenly after rain, preventing rot and ensuring a long lifespan.
Options
Hand-Split Shakes
For a rugged, textured appearance. These shakes are thicker and have an irregular surface that creates deep shadow lines, perfect for a bold, custom look.
Tapersawn Shakes
A hybrid option that offers the thickness of a shake but the smooth, sawn appearance of a shingle. This provides a cleaner, more tailored look while maintaining the durability of a thicker cut.
Cedar Shingles
Sawn smooth on both sides, these are thinner and lay flatter than shakes. They offer a refined, uniform appearance often seen on Cape Cod or Colonial-style homes.

Is cedar the only type of wood shingle out there?
No, you can also find wood shingles and shakes made of redwood, cypress, and pressure-treated pine.
How many years will a cedar roof last?
Cedar roofs can last up to 25-35 years with proper maintenance.
Does it cost more than regular asphalt shingles?
A cedar roof will cost more than an asphalt shingle roof upfront. However, the extra life you can get out of a cedar roof makes it competitively priced with an asphalt roof.
Is cedar roofing fireproof?
There are some areas that are prone to wildfires that prohibit wood roofing, so be sure to check with your building department first. Non-treated materials have a Class C fire rating, but you can also find treated cedar shakes and shingles.
